Use when the user asks to "verify citations", "check references", "validate paper citations", or "evaluate reference relevance". It extracts references from LaTeX/PDF papers, checks formatting rules, verifies existence via Crossref / Semantic Scholar / OpenAlex / PubMed / arXiv / dblp / Google Scholar / WebSearch, and scores thematic/semantic relevance.

How to use it

Copy the folder

Take color4-alt/citecheck from the repository into ~/.claude/skills for personal use, or into .claude/skills inside a project.

Check the name does not clash

The agent identifies a skill by the name field in its header. Two skills with the same name cannot sit side by side — one of them will be ignored.

Install what it needs

The instructions reference pip. Without those the skill loads but fails at the first command.
